Sparse Differential Resultant for Laurent Differential Polynomials
Abstract
In this paper, we first introduce the concept of Laurent differentially essential systems and give a criterion for Laurent differentially essential systems in terms of their supports. Then the sparse differential resultant for a Laurent differentially essential system is defined and its basic properties are proved. In particular, order and degree bounds for the sparse differential resultant are given. Based on these bounds, an algorithm to compute the sparse differential resultant is proposed, which is single exponential in terms of the number of indeterminates, the Jacobi number of the system, and the size of the system.
